7
ответов

В чем разница между istringstream, ostringstream и stringstream? / Почему бы не использовать stringstream в каждом случае?

Когда я буду использовать std :: istringstream, std :: ostringstream и std :: stringstream, и почему я не должен просто использовать std :: stringstream в каждом сценарии (есть ли проблемы с производительностью во время выполнения?). Наконец, это ...
вопрос задан: 1 February 2016 15:33
6
ответов

Как я проверяю, является ли строка C++ интервалом?

Когда я использую getline, я ввел бы набор строк или чисел, но я только хочу, чтобы цикл с условием продолжения произвел "слово", если это не число. Так есть ли какой-либо способ проверить, является ли "слово" числом или нет? Я...
вопрос задан: 3 June 2010 10:20
5
ответов

путаница преобразования строк, строк и символов *

Мой вопрос можно свести к следующему: где строка, возвращенная из stringstream.str (). C_str (), находится в памяти и почему ее нельзя присвоить const char *? Этот пример кода объяснит это ...
вопрос задан: 6 May 2015 06:27
5
ответов

Получение значения байта с помощью stringstream

У меня есть этот (неправильный) пример кода для того, чтобы вытащить значение из stringstream и сохранить его в переменной размера байта (это должно быть в единственном var байта, не интервале): #include <iostream> #...
вопрос задан: 28 July 2010 19:34
5
ответов

Как вызвать станд.:: оператор stringstream>> для чтения всей строки?

Как вызвать станд.:: оператор stringstream>> для чтения всей строки вместо того, чтобы остановиться в первом пробеле? У меня есть шаблонный класс, который хранит значение, считанное из текстового файла: шаблон <...
вопрос задан: 16 July 2009 09:27
4
ответа

Stringstream извлекают целое число

Почему мне не удается извлечь целочисленное значение в Цифровую переменную? #include <поток> #include <вектор> #include <iostream> использование станд. пространства имен; международное основное () {представляет Цифры в виде строки ("
вопрос задан: 27 December 2015 22:15
4
ответа

станд. перенаправления:: суд пользовательскому устройству записи

Я хочу использовать этот отрывок от г-на-Edd's iostreams статья для печати станд.:: засоритесь где-нибудь. #include <iostream> #include <iomanip> #include <строка> #include <поток> международное основное ()...
вопрос задан: 27 August 2013 14:10
4
ответа

Существует ли способ уменьшить ostringstream malloc/free's?

Я пишу встроенное приложение. В некоторых местах я использую станд.:: ostringstream много, так как это очень удобно в моих целях. Однако я просто обнаружил, что хит производительности является экстремальным значением начиная с добавления...
вопрос задан: 1 March 2010 18:27
4
ответа

C++: что предлагают строковые потоки преимуществ?

кто-либо мог сказать мне о некоторых практических примерах при использовании строковых потоков в C++, т.е. приписывания и вывода к строковому потоку с помощью потоковой вставки и потоковых операторов извлечения?
вопрос задан: 25 February 2010 14:51
4
ответа

Как считать содержание файла в istringstream?

Для улучшения производительности, читающей из файла, я пытаюсь считать все содержание большого файла (на несколько МБ) в память и затем использовать istringstream для доступа к информации. Мой вопрос...
вопрос задан: 25 September 2008 20:42
3
ответа

std :: istringstream: трудности с обработкой ошибок при чтении отрицательных значений в неподписанные переменные [duplicate]

Я использую std :: istringstream для синтаксического анализа строк в течение длительного времени, и чтение правильных значений никогда не было проблемой. Тем не менее, я обнаружил некоторые трудности и странности, выполняющие операции ...
вопрос задан: 3 April 2018 14:21
3
ответа

Как я преобразовываю из stringstream для строкового представления в C++?

Как делают я преобразовываю из станд.:: stringstream к станд.:: строка в C++? Я должен назвать метод на строковом потоке?
вопрос задан: 13 October 2017 16:58
3
ответа

Почему был станд.:: strstream удержан от использования?

Я недавно обнаружил что станд.:: strstream был удержан от использования в пользу станд.:: stringstream. Это было некоторое время, так как я использовал его, но это сделало то, что я должен был сделать в то время, так был удивлен услышать...
вопрос задан: 15 April 2017 21:58
3
ответа

Эквивалентный из %02d со станд.:: stringstream?

Я хочу произвести целое число к станд.:: stringstream с эквивалентным форматом %02d printf. Есть ли более легкий способ достигнуть этого, чем: станд.:: поток stringstream; stream.setfill ('0'); stream.setw (...
вопрос задан: 5 August 2016 22:21
3
ответа

Как использовать Строковые Потоки C++ для добавления интервала?

кто-либо мог сказать мне или указать на меня на простой пример того, как добавить интервал к stringstream, содержащему слово "Something" (или какое-либо слово)?
вопрос задан: 17 July 2016 19:54
3
ответа

C++: вставьте символ в строку

таким образом, я пытаюсь вставить символ, который я получил от строки к другой строке. Здесь я мои действия: 1. Я хочу использовать простой: someString.insert (somePosition, myChar); 2. Я получил ошибку, потому что...
вопрос задан: 11 July 2010 13:58
3
ответа

Превращение временного stringstream к c_str () в отдельном операторе

Рассмотрите следующую функцию: освободите f (символ константы* ул.); предположим, что я хочу генерировать строку с помощью stringstream и передать ее этой функции. Если я хочу сделать это в одном операторе, я мог бы попробовать: f ((...
вопрос задан: 12 March 2010 13:44
3
ответа

Установка точности для stringstream глобально

Я использую stringstream в своем всем проекте, который имеет больше чем 30 файлов. Я недавно overcomed проблема, вызванная stringstring, где я анализировал вдвое большее по сравнению с stringstream и, был точностью...
вопрос задан: 4 March 2010 20:19
2
ответа

Как скопировать из одного объекта stringstream в другой в C ++?

У меня есть объект std :: stringstream ss1. Теперь я хотел бы создать еще одну копию из этого. Я пытаюсь это: std :: stringstream ss2 = ss1; или: std :: stringstream ss2 (ss1) не работает. Ошибка ...
вопрос задан: 8 May 2018 10:45
2
ответа

Движение от строки до stringstream к вектору <интервал>

У меня есть этот пример программы шага, который я хочу реализовать на своем приложении. Я хочу к push_back международные элементы на строке отдельно в вектор. Как может я? #include <iostream> #...
вопрос задан: 11 December 2016 19:39
2
ответа

Как вы очищаете переменную stringstream?

Я уже пробовал несколько вещей, std :: stringstream m; m.empty (); m.clear (); оба из которых не работают.
вопрос задан: 3 September 2015 20:29
2
ответа

Если я предварительно выделяю станд.:: stringstream?

Я использую станд.:: stringstream экстенсивно для построения строк и сообщений об ошибках в моем приложении. stringstreams являются обычно очень короткими жизненными автоматическими переменными. Будет такая "куча" причины использования...
вопрос задан: 17 December 2011 20:19
2
ответа

stringstream не был объявлен в этом объеме

У меня есть проблема с stringstream.my Visual Studio, ни Linux g ++ может понять stingstream. Я добавил поток, но он does'nt решает что-либо. Я работал с ним прежде и действительно не знаю что'...
вопрос задан: 21 June 2010 17:46
2
ответа

C ++: вектор в строку

Я хочу знать, возможно ли преобразовать std :: vector в std :: stringstream, используя универсальное программирование, и как этого добиться?
вопрос задан: 9 June 2010 17:17
2
ответа

Поток от станд.:: строка, не делая копию?

У меня есть сетевой клиент с методом запроса, который берет станд.:: streambuf*. Этот метод реализован повышением:: iostreams:: копирование его к пользовательскому станд.:: streambuf-производный-класс, который знает как к...
вопрос задан: 19 October 2009 17:39
2
ответа

stringstream временный ostream возвращают проблему

Я создаю регистратор со следующими разделами://#define ЖУРНАЛ (x)//для режима выпуска #define ЖУРНАЛ (x) журнал (x) журнал (константа string& ул.); журнал (константа ostream& ул.); С идеей сделать: ЖУРНАЛ ("...
вопрос задан: 10 October 2009 07:48
2
ответа

Почему stringstreams rdbuf () и ул. () предоставление мне другой вывод?

У меня есть этот код, международное основное () {станд.:: строка Св.; станд.:: stringstream ss; ss <<"hej hej медиана роют" <<станд.:: endl; станд.:: getline (ss, Св.''); станд.:: суд <<"ss.rdbuf ()-> ул. ()...
вопрос задан: 7 April 2009 21:51
1
ответ

Как работает это смещение прав: stringstream > > unsigned int > > без знака int?

Я работаю с книгой SFML Game Development by examples, и я не совсем понимаю, что делает это предложение. Я никогда не видел ничего подобного void. Anim_Directional :: ReadIn (std :: stringstream & amp; ...
вопрос задан: 17 March 2019 12:44
1
ответ

Запись stringstream содержание в ofstream

Я в настоящее время использую станд.:: ofstream следующим образом: станд.:: ofstream outFile; outFile.open (output_file); Затем я пытаюсь передать станд.:: stringstream возражают против outFile следующим образом: GetHolesResults (..., станд.::...
вопрос задан: 16 October 2015 17:30
1
ответ

Как очистить stringstream? [дубликат]

синтаксический анализатор stringstream; синтаксический анализатор <<5; короткая вершина = 0; синтаксический анализатор>> вершина; parser.str ("");//ЗДЕСЬ я СБРАСЫВАЮ синтаксический анализатор синтаксического анализатора <<6;//н
вопрос задан: 11 January 2012 13:39